Hi Im installing an Amp into My Boot and I want to run a new Circuit From the battery through the firewall to the boot, I was wondering if any of u have done something like or have found an easy way to Run the Cable from the Battery to the boot. I have a 94 VR Commodore.

if you look from the engine bay, to the right hand side of the brake booster (big black round thing on the drivers side) there is a grommit where the clutch cable would be in a manual. pop the grommit out, drill/cut a hole in it, and run cable through there, then put grommit back in hole.

then just run it down underneath the trim panels down the side. pull the rear seat out and run the cable with the existing harness.
